So I just picked up a 99 civic HB last Thursday and when I test drove it everything was flawless and quite... well over the last few days I have noticed a ticking noise coming from the engine when I accelerate. After about a mile or so the noise goes away completely. I stopped by my local NAPA in search of a universal antenna and the guy that checked me out happened to be a Honda enthusiast. He came out and listened to it and claimed that the valves just need to be adjusted and that its nothing really to worry about. Now… I don’t know too much about cars (yet) but I was hoping that maybe someone could help me out with this issue and give me a little more insight? Also if it does just need a valve job could anyone recommend me a shop in the Des Moines area that would be trustworthy and maybe the average going rate of a valve job?

It is probably just a loose valve. You do no need a valve job, you just need to adjust them. It says to do it every 15000 miles on my car, it is probably about the same with yours. Get a haynes/chilton manual and it will show you how to do it. Get with someone who knows how to use a feeler guage to show you how much "grab" you need to have. The only special tools you might need are a feeler guage (the bent kind and maybee a offset wrench or they make special wrenches for doing it also. It is at most an hour job if you have never done it before.
Toffee: You have the same engine as me, you are supposed to adjust your valves every 15000 miles!
mvracing: Hondas are notorious for having valve tap noise, because most people don't adjust them when they are supposed to. Don't assume it is a bent rod just because of valve tap.
